Hiiragiya offers traditional guest rooms featuring tatami mat flooring and sliding shoji doors. The ryokan includes both Japanese-style rooms with futon bedding and Western-style rooms with modern amenities. Each room provides views of the tranquil courtyard gardens.
Culinary Experience
The hotel serves kaiseki cuisine, a traditional multi-course dinner that showcases seasonal and local ingredients. Guests can enjoy breakfast and dinner in the privacy of their rooms or in a communal dining area. Attention to detail in meal presentation is a hallmark of the culinary offerings.
Location
Hiiragiya is strategically located in the Gion district, known for its historic streets and vibrant culture. The hotel is within walking distance of famous attractions like Kiyomizu-dera Temple and the Yasaka Shrine. Scenic gardens and traditional tea houses add to the cultural richness surrounding the ryokan.

Cultural Engagement
Hiiragiya offers guests a chance to participate in traditional tea ceremonies conducted by skilled tea masters. Cultural workshops may include calligraphy and kimono wearing sessions. Authentic cultural experiences are incorporated in the guest stay, providing deeper insights into Japanese traditions.
